HONOURS

Students are invited to express their interest in enrolling into a BABS Honours program by submitting the appropriate form/s.

  • UNSW students need to submit the BABS Honours Application Form to the BABS Student Office. 
  • Students applying from an institution other than UNSW need to complete the BABS Honours Application Form AND an External Student Application Form.

Acceptance is contingent upon satisfying UNSW admission and academic requirements, and available resources within the School. Students are encouraged to approach team leaders for further information about Honours projects at any time.
